serilog

    1

    1答えて

    Serilogでの作業を開始したばかりですが、かなりいいですが、ちょっと混乱しています。 私のコントローラのアクションでエラーが発生した場合は、リクエスト(ヘッダー、パラメータなど)からという便利な情報をにできるだけ記録します。 どうすればいいですか?あなたは、リンクからドキュメントを1としてEnrichment機能 を使用して見て可能性があり

    2

    1答えて

    私はOwinパイプラインでLogContextを使用して単純な濃縮を追加しようとしている マイロガーの設定私ができるログに // configure logger Log.Logger = new LoggerConfiguration() .Enrich.WithProperty("B", 2) .ReadFrom.AppSettings() .Enr

    1

    1答えて

    asp.netコアのSerilog.Sinks.FileとSerilog.Extensions.Logging.Fileパッケージの違いは何ですか? 私はSerilogでasp.netコアプロジェクトのロギングを実装しようとしましたが、Serilog.Sinks.Fileを使用した簡単な例hereが見つかりました。 私のプロジェクトで同じものを実装しようとしたとき、ロガーファクトリは拡張子AddF

    3

    1答えて

    本番環境でロギングレベルをデバッグからエラーに変更することが可能であるかどうかを理解したいと思います。 Nlogには、設定ファイル内にログの細かさを設定できる場所があります。 <level value="Info" /> これは、デバッグレベルのエラーを取得するためにUAT環境でその場で変更することができ、その後しばらくして、私は戻っINFOにそれを変更することができます。これは単なる設定の変

    0

    1答えて

    私はasp.netコアで新しく、私の概念をクリアするためのサンプルプロジェクトを作りたいと思います。私はasp.netコアでSerilogを使用してロガーを作成したいのですが、私はproject.jsonファイルにserilogのリファレンスを追加する際に問題に直面しています。 それはエラーを示しています。私はたくさんのが、見つかりません解決策をグーグル framework.NETCoreApp、

    1

    1答えて

    Serilog.Sinks.MSSqlServerCore(1.1.0)をSerilog.Settings.Configuration(2.2.0)で使用しようとしています。 Serilog.Settings.Configurationは、FileおよびSeqのようなシンクでうまく動作します。 Serilog.Sinks.MSSqlServerCoreをproject.jsonに追加してプログラム

    1

    1答えて

    私はSerilogを使用しています。私は含まれているクラスのSourceContextでログエントリを書きたいと思います。むしろ、上記のようなタイプのために共有するものを作成するよりも、 using Serilog; ... class Foo { private static readonly ILogger Log = Serilog.Log.ForContext

    1

    1答えて

    Serilogシンクを使用していますSerilog.Sinks.Email。 私は電子メールを受け取ります。残念ながら "情報"もあります。 警告エラーまたは致命的な場合は、まず電子メールを受信したいと考えています。 これを設定する方法はありますか? 「情報」はもはや電子メールで送信されるべきではありません。 BUT .txtファイルに情報を書き直す必要があります。 警告、エラーまたは致命的な場合

    0

    1答えて

    このスカラー値をシンク内の2つの別々のプロパティに変換できますか? シンクは、Martenを使用してpostgresql内にlogonventをjsonオブジェクトとして格納します。私のJSONオブジェクトで var sensorInput = new { Latitude = 25, Longitude = 134 }; Log.Information("Test {sensorInput}"

    1

    1答えて

    私のアプリは現在、Serilogバージョン1.5をロギングに使用しており、Serilog 2.3.0にアップグレードすることに決めました。 PermitCrossAppDomainCallsのアップグレード時にコンパイル時エラーが発生しました。プロパティがSerilog v2.3でサポートされている場合、任意のアイデアですか? エラー行: LogContext.PermitCrossAppDoma